
The origin of the first name "Iiya" is predominantly Russian. It is a variant spelling of the name "Ilya," which is derived from the Greek name "Elias" or "Elijah." "Ilya" is a popular given name in Russia and other Slavic countries.

Ilya is a name with historical significance in various parts of the world, and there have been several famous individuals bearing this name. In Russian history, one notable figure is Ilya Muromets, a legendary hero and epic protagonist known for his immense strength and courage. Moving to the realm of literature, Ilya Ehrenburg was a renowned Soviet writer and journalist who played a significant role in shaping Soviet literature during the early 20th century. Meanwhile, in the world of sports, Ilya Kovalchuk stands out as a prominent ice hockey player, representing Russia in international competitions and leaving a mark in the NHL with his exceptional skills on the ice. Additionally, Ilya Prigogine, a Russian-born Belgian physical chemist, gained fame for his contributions to the understanding of complex systems and the concept of self-organization. These individuals, among others, have brought prestige to the name Ilya through their exceptional achievements in different fields.
Ilya is a popular and diverse name that has various spellings and forms in different cultures and regions of the world. In Russian, it is commonly spelled as "Ilya" (Илья) and pronounced as "ee-lyah." This version of the name is derived from the biblical figure Elijah and is widely used in Russia and other Slavic countries. In Hebrew, the name is spelled as "Eliyah" (אֵלִיָּהוּ) or "Eliyahu" (אֵלִיָּהוּ), which also means "my God is Yahweh." In English-speaking countries, the name may be written as "Ilya" or "Iliya," and it has gained popularity as a unique and modern choice. Moreover, the name may have variations in other languages, such as "Ilja" in German, "İlya" in Turkish, and "Ilia" in Greek and Georgian. Despite the diverse spellings and pronunciations, Ilya remains a powerful and meaningful name across different cultures.
